A Guide To Health Insurance Options

There is a large offer of health insurance options in the public health system, but when you come to choose the right one, you’ll see that the possibilities have narrowed down to just a few. Fewer benefits and higher costs, this is what you can expect when your health insurance options are not employer-sponsored. Nevertheless, a growing number of consumers now prefer individual health insurance options because employers provide a lower coverage and charge a high share of costs. Unfortunately, no form of protection against premium increase is available at the moment. Therefore, health insurance options have to be sought elsewhere.

The Steps

Before deciding for an individual or family policy, it is important to talk to several insurers and learn about their terms and conditions, and compare the policy benefits included. Affordable coverage is often a rarity for patients with chronic ailments. A high-risk insurance pool could be a safety net under very dire circumstances. Such health insurance options often represent a solution to reducing the large number of uninsured. Yet, costs are usually the elements that make a difference between the various health insurance options, and the rates of private plans and more special policies are out of reach for many workers.

Do It Right

The best one can do under the circumstances is to shop according to a set budget, to check and compare different policies and carefully read all the benefits, terms and conditions. Moreover, people should look more at family health policies in order to have every family member insured in optimal conditions. Find out about the number of treatments and the tax deduction for the health insurance rates, because such elements make the difference between good and bad health insurance policies.
